This week we’re supposed to write about “your business epiphany – what one moment influenced your career or business more than any other?”
Epiphanies are funny things. What we think is an epiphany (AKA, an ah-ha!! moment) when it happens may become more mundane in 20/20 hindsight, whereas a passing thought becomes monumental wisdom in that same hindsight.
What epiphanies I can identify fall in the second category.
Here is the one that’s had the greatest impact on me, because it stopped my laying all those coulda/shoulda/woulda trips on myself.
